Arcetyp LLC is looking for an Administrative Assistant (Front Desk / Data Entry) Onsite at Robins AFB GA to support a US Government client. All work under this contract shall be performed at the Government site. This work is full time onsite at Robins AFB GA. 

Position Overview

The Administrative Assistant (Front Desk / Data Entry) provides essential customer service, administrative, and data management support to the Military & Family Readiness Center (M&FRC) at Robins Air Force Base. This position serves as the primary point of contact for clients, delivering professional front desk reception services, coordinating scheduling for programs and services, and maintaining accurate data within Air Force and Department of Defense systems. The role requires strong organizational, communication, and technical skills to ensure efficient service delivery, accurate reporting, and compliance with performance standards. The Administrative Assistant operates in a dynamic, customer-facing environment supporting military members and their families, ensuring timely assistance, professional interactions, and high-quality administrative execution.

Position Functions / Roles

Customer Service and Front Desk Operations

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for M&FRC clients, greeting visitors and answering telephone calls
  • Determine client needs and direct individuals to appropriate program staff or services
  • Provide clear and accurate information regarding M&FRC programs, services, and scheduling
  • Maintain a professional, organized, and welcoming front desk environment

Scheduling and Program Support

  • Schedule clients for classes, workshops, and Transition Assistance Program (TAP) services
  • Coordinate appointment availability and communicate scheduling details to clients
  • Send reminder communications (e.g., emails) in accordance with program timelines

Data Entry

  • Input and maintain accurate client and program data in AFFIRST and other designated systems
  • Ensure data accuracy meets required performance thresholds (e.g., ≥85% accuracy within required timelines)
  • Maintain current and complete records in accordance with program requirements
  • Generate monthly reports on client usage and service metrics

Administrative and Reporting Support

  • Maintain records of client sign-ins and service utilization
  • Prepare and submit recurring reports to the M&FRC leadership and Contracting Officer Representative (COR)
  • Support general administrative functions including document preparation and data tracking

Performance and Quality Assurance

  • Meet established service standards, including responsiveness to customer interactions and accuracy of work
  • Ensure all tasks are completed in accordance with PWS requirements and performance metrics
  • Maintain professionalism and adherence to Government policies and procedures

Security and Compliance

  • Safeguard Government information, equipment, and systems
  • Comply with Privacy Act requirements and all applicable security protocols
  • Participate in required training and maintain compliance with installation and system access requirements

Coordination and Communication

  • Work closely with Government personnel, program managers, and M&FRC staff
  • Communicate effectively with a diverse client population including military members and families
  • Support awareness and utilization of M&FRC programs and services
